[SRRA]: New Notice available for Response Action Outcomes (RAOs) - Naturally Occurring Levels of Constituents in Ground Water

The Department is aware that the Model Response Action Outcome (RAO) Document promulgated as Appendix D in the Administrative Requirements for the Remediation for Contaminated Sites (ARRCS, N.J.A.C. 7:26C) does not address certain situations that may occur at sites where remediations are concluding. When appropriate, the Department works with remediating parties and LSRPs to ensure that RAOs accurately reflect site-specific conditions and implemented remedial actions. To that extent, the Department has created RAO Notices for use by LSRPs when writing RAOs. Notices for several conditions, as well as a description of the Department's approval process for other RAO modifications, were posted on the Department's website at
https://www.nj.gov/dep/srp/ on April 29, 2013.

A new Notice has been developed to address exceedances of the New Jersey Ground Water Remediation Standards caused by naturally occurring constituents found in ground water. This discussion primarily applies to metals, and excludes anthropogenic background including, but not limited to, synthetic organic chemicals such as petroleum hydrocarbons/byproducts, chlorinated compounds, and any compound that cannot be considered naturally occurring.
